Rivers Rerun: PDP Demands Immediate Arrest Of Amaechi, Peterside, Abe, Others

The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) has called for an immediate arrest and prosecution of the Minister of Transportation and former governor of Rivers state, Rotimi Amaechi, the All Progressives Congress (APC) candidate in last year’s guber election, Dr Dakuku Peterside, and Senator Magnus Abe over violence that occurred during Saturday’ s poll in Rivers state.

This was contained in a statement signed by the chairman of the Rivers State chapter of the PDP, Bro. Felix Obuah.

Obuah accused the APC leaders, alongside Jukaye Flag Amachree and others of masterminding the violence, killings and various electoral malpractices in some parts of the State.

The PDP chairman demanded the arrest and prosecution of Mr. Barry Mpigi for hijacking electoral materials in Tai LGA to his home town, Koroma, with the aid of the military, and accused the former Commissioner for Youth in the State, Mr. Felix Nwaeke, of conniving with an Army captain, and absconding with all electoral materials for ward 2, Obeakpu, in Oyigbo LGA.

The party said the involvement of the military emboldened the APC chieftains to carry out nefarious conducts during the exercise in the state.

The PDP Chairman bemoaned the assassination attempt on the Chief of Staff, Government House, Engr. Emeka Woke, the assault on the Secretary to the State Government, Hon Kenneth Kobani and other PDP leaders, who had been marked for arrest and detention by the APC- federal government.
